August 20, 2009 rematch from Sept. 2007 met with sweet success! First morning three hours into the hunt over two water holes I arrowed him at 15 yards and he was a dead Pronghorn walking and down in 10 seconds. Double lunged pronghorn don't go far, this one trotted off about 70 yards and performed the death wobble before following over. It's way cool to watch your animal fall down dead. It leaves no question in your mind about how your shot placement went.
